solve the following systems algebraically.
A.) x+2y=17
x-y=2
B) 4x+5y=11
2x+6y=16
C) 4x-3y=-10
x= 1/4y-1
D) 2x+y= -2x+5
3x+2y= 2x = 3y
I'll do a couple for you:
A. x + 2y = 17
x - y = 2
Subtract the second equation from the first, term by term
x - x + 2y - (-y) = 17 - 2
or 3y = 15
Divide both sides by 3
y = 5
Put this back into the first equation
x +2*5 = 17
x + 10 = 17
x = 17 - 10
x = 7
B. 4x + 5y = 11
2x + 6y = 16
Double all the terms in the second equation to get the number of x's the same as in the first equation
4x + 12y = 32
Subtract the first equation from the third equation term by term
4x - 4x + 12y - 5y = 32 - 11
or 7y = 21
Divide by 7
y = 3
Put this back into the first equation
4x + 5*3 = 11
4x + 15 = 11
4x = -4
x = -1
